Adding Parts Express foam gasket tape to my 1980 Heresys

I found a 50 foot roll of Parts Express 1/8" thick, 3/8" wide foam speaker gasket on eBay that I should be getting in a week or so.  I'm going to use it to seal the backs of the 1980 Heresys I just purchased.  Since I'll have a ton of extra I'm wondering what else I should use it for in the speakers?  Should I use it for all the drivers?  Small piece behind the input terminal wires inside the back panel?

Looks like the gasket tape should be arriving today.  Thanks for everyone's suggestions!  😁

 

I'm going to seal the cabinet back with it, seal each of the drivers and also put a small piece behind the input terminals.  I know my 1981 Heresy center has gasket tape sealing the back already but I'm not sure about the drivers.  Since I'll have so much extra I'll do the drivers and input terminal on that as well.

I put a 1/8 inch neoprene on the back hatch of both 1980 and 1984. 1984 are also lined with egg crate foam as they are super Heresy recipe. 

 

Do you still have the original terminal strips? I replaced mine with 5 way binding posts, much better!

I didn’t try to, just put in new holes as I covered the inside of the back panel fully with 1/8 inch neoprene, and I wanted to move the posts to bottom of the panel.  I need to go back and fill the holes and repaint the outside of the panel for the 1980 set.

 

I converted the 1984 to super Heresy which use a port, so I made a new back panel for those.

 

i bought these from parts express... inexpensive but really solid.
